> Have you tried booting from a Win95 floppy disk and see if you can > access that partition from a DOS prompt? Because if what I'm suggesting > did happen, your Win95 boot record is overwritten with Lilo, and you > won't be able to access your C drive. > > Actually, I hope I'm wrong for your sake.
It's not that bad. You should be able to access your C drive, but the boot files will be overwritten. So just boot off a win95 floppy and run: C:\WINDOWS\COMMAND\SYS.COM A:\ C: This will copy the boot files from your floppy to your win9x partition.
